                          The condition called sperm When the genetic material in sperm is broken or damaged, DNA fragmentation takes place.. Even when using assisted reproductive treatments, this impairment can impact male fertility and lower the likelihood of a successful pregnancy. A more comprehensive diagnostic method than a typical semen analysis, the sperm DNA fragmentation test assesses the integrity of sperm DNA.

                         Identifying and testing for this condition is essential for couples who are experiencing infertility that can’t be explained, miscarriages, or repeated IVF failures. Our Procedure for Sperm DNA Fragmentation Will Include:

  • TUNEL Assay: By applying tied nucleotides to the damaged regions, this technique finds DNA breaks. The amount of photons emitted is then used to determine the degree of DNA fragmentation under a microscope.
  • Sperm Chromatin Dispersion (SCD): undamaged DNA surrounds the nucleus in a halo when the sperm are subjected to a denaturing solution. This halo is diminished or nonexistent in fragmented sperm, signifying damage to the DNA.
  • Sperm Chromatin Structure Assay (SCSA): Acridine orange is used in this test to stain sperm. The degree of DNA fragmentation is shown by the fluorescence level, which can be either red or green. More DNA damage is indicated by a higher red fluorescence ratio.
  • Comet Assay: Using this method, sperm are placed on a gel substance, where DNA fragmentation test results in the formation of a comet-like tail. DNA fragmentation increases with tail length.

FAQs

1. What is sperm DNA fragmentation (SDF)?

    SDF is when the genetic material in sperm is damaged, affecting fertility and pregnancy outcomes.

2. What causes sperm DNA fragmentation?

    It can be caused by oxidative stress, infections, varicocele, smoking, obesity, and other unhealthy lifestyle factors.

3. What are the tests to detect sperm DNA fragmentation?

    Common tests include TUNEL Assay, Sperm Chromatin Dispersion (SCD), Sperm Chromatin Structure Assay (SCSA), and Comet Assay.

4. Why should sperm DNA fragmentation be tested?

    Testing for SDF helps identify fertility issues and provides insights into the causes of infertility, especially in unexplained cases.

5. What are the benefits of testing sperm DNA fragmentation?

    Testing helps doctors make informed decisions about fertility treatments and interventions to improve reproductive outcomes.

6. What is the TUNEL Assay?

    The TUNEL Assay detects DNA breaks by adding labeled nucleotides to damaged areas, which are then assessed under a microscope.

7. What is the Sperm Chromatin Structure Assay (SCSA)?

    SCSA uses acridine orange to stain sperm and measures DNA fragmentation by comparing red and green fluorescence.
